Steyning Town 1-1 Croydon Athletic: Croydon Athletic Held to Another League Draw

It was another away day for Croydon Athletic, following a gutting defeat in the Velocity Cup midweek. Despite the setback, there were positives to take from the performance, particularly the fact that the debutants from the previous match retained their places in the starting XI after solid individual displays.

The match started with Steyning Town almost taking an early lead. A weak headed backpass was intercepted by the home side’s striker, but his attempted lob sailed over the bar. However, it wasn’t long before the visitors found their stride and we took the lead in the 31st minute. Two of the debutants combined for the goal—Figueira danced down the right flank before delivering a pinpoint cross that was met by Dreher, who confidently dispatched the ball into the net.

The home side responded quickly, and goalkeeper Tangara was forced into action, making a crucial save to deny a Steyning Town effort from the edge of the box. Shortly after, Tangara showed his alertness once more, pouncing on a dangerous ball bouncing from a cross and thwarting a Steyning chance.

The second half brought a flurry of chances for both sides. Pierrick broke through the Steyning defence and surged toward the penalty box, only to be brilliantly halted by a last-ditch challenge on the edge of the six-yard box. Croydon looked to extend their lead, but Steyning Town had other ideas. They pulled level in spectacular fashion in the 68th minute when Howick picked up the ball on the halfway line, surged forward, and unleashed a thunderous strike from 40 yards out that rocketed into the top corner of the net. Tangara had no chance of stopping it — you’d need 5 goalkeepers to even got close to that strike.

The equaliser galvanised Croydon’s attack. Diallo delivered a superb cross into the box, only for it to be cleared off the line. Dotse then had a chance at the near post, but his effort was tipped over the bar by the Steyning keeper. At the other end, Tangara continued his heroics, producing a stunning full-stretch save to keep the score level when Barnes found space in the box and unleashed a powerful volley from the edge.

Croydon Athletic pushed for a winner, with Serbonij appealing for a late penalty after a challenge in the box, but the referee waved away the claims. A couple more half-chances came and went as the match drew to a close, and the final whistle blew, leaving the boys with the feeling that it was yet another two points dropped despite a very solid performance.

The draw leaves Croydon Athletic in 10th place in the league table, with work to do if they are to climb into the playoff spots. But with showings like this the team will be hopeful of picking up more points in the coming weeks.
